Day 1: Magic at Ba Na Hills

Starting early at 7:30 am, the adventure begins with a pickup from your accommodation to Sun World Ba Na Hills, reaching this mountain resort via the famous Cable Car. As you ascend, expect panoramic views of Da Nang’s coastline and lush mountains. The cable car ride is a highlight in itself, with some reviewers noting the breathtaking vistas that make the journey memorable.

Once at the top, you’ll visit the Dream Stream Cable Car Station and marvel at the Golden Bridge, a marvel of modern architecture that appears to hold up the sky with its giant stone hands. The bridge’s blend of engineering and art makes it a must-see, especially if you enjoy Instagram-worthy views. Other attractions, like the Le Jardin Damour and Debay Wine Cellar, are included in the ticket, giving you the chance to explore gardens and sample local wines.

Day 2: Cultural and Scenic Journey to Hue

The second day kicks off with a pickup at your hotel in Hoi An around 7:00-7:30 am, with the group crossing the scenic Hai Van Pass—a highlight for many travelers. Known as one of the world’s best coastal roads, this route offers stunning vistas of mountains meeting the sea. A stop at Lap An Lagoon provides a perfect photo opportunity, with reviewers praising its beauty.

Next, the tour visits the Khai Dinh Tomb, a site that beautifully blends Eastern and Western architectural styles. The intricate details and elegant design make it a favorite stop, with comments highlighting its artistic merit. Around midday, you’ll enjoy a local Hue cuisine lunch, a welcome chance to savor authentic flavors in a scenic restaurant.

In the afternoon, explore Hue Imperial City—the former palace of the Nguyen Kings. The Ngo Mon Gate, Thai Hoa Palace, and Nine Dynastic Urns are some key sights. The guide offers rich insights into the site’s history, making the experience both educational and visually impressive. The visit concludes with a peaceful stop at Thien Mu Pagoda, a site deeply linked with Hue’s spiritual and cultural identity.

Day 3: Local Life and Heritage

Day three is packed with authentic encounters. You’ll start with a Coconut Boat ride in Cam Thanh village, where local fishermen show their craft. The hands-on experience of fishing with round nets and cast nets is both fun and insightful, giving a taste of daily Vietnamese life. Reviewers have noted how engaging and friendly the local fishermen are during this activity.

Later, a visit to My Son Sanctuary, a UNESCO World Heritage site, introduces you to the ancient Cham civilization. Walking around the ruins, most guests comment on the impressive architecture and historical significance. The two-hour exploration allows enough time to absorb the site’s atmosphere and learn about its cultural importance.

Day 4: Island Escape and Hoi An Charm

The final day begins with a boat trip to Cham Island, a designated biosphere reserve. Traveling by speed boat, you’ll enjoy the cooling breeze and scenic views of the coast. At Lang Beach, many travelers find the setting relaxing, with clear waters and soft sands, perfect for a few hours of leisure.

In the afternoon, the tour shifts to a Hoi An City Tour. Visiting the vibrant Hoi An Market and the iconic Phuc Kien Chinese Assembly Hall, you’ll experience the town’s lively atmosphere. Walking through narrow lanes lined with lanterns and ancient buildings, you’ll appreciate the blend of Chinese, Japanese, and Vietnamese influences. The tour wraps up around 6-7 pm, with plenty of time to enjoy the town’s evening ambiance.
